Output 908325deae684a87efd131671ed9b5d69029a1b4b9e8e43f30d9fe4e115aa866:2

value
1002607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b14c2ff4b16dee80851a20f576eb164ed23fd10 OP_EQUAL
address
38Y1UUnHJVuxrvbuv4va3Fqng6wfM8fJgd
transaction
908325deae684a87efd131671ed9b5d69029a1b4b9e8e43f30d9fe4e115aa866
spent
true